BACKGROUND
Progressive Processing, LLC, located in Dubuque, Iowa, is a wholly owned subsidiary
of Hormel Foods Corporation. The plant officially opened on January 25, 2010 when it
produced its first run of Hormel® Compleats® microwave meals. Along with microwave
meals, the plant also runs a line of canned chunk chicken, and after an expansion in
2015, the plant now also produces SPAM® and Bacon Bits.
In 2019, Hormel Foods Corporation and Progressive Processing, LLC expanded the
Dubuque Progressive Processing facility to add capacity in SPAM® production. The
company invested approximately $13 million in remodeling and machinery/equipment.
The company created 58 new jobs with this expansion, 14 of which qualified for the
IEDA High Quality Jobs Incentive Program.
DISCUSSION
On June 6, 2022, the City Council adopted Resolution 210-22, authorizing the Mayor to
execute an application to the IEDA for financial assistance, and directing the City
Manager to submit the application to the IEDA with other required documents.
On June 14, 2022, the IEDA approved Economic Development Assistance Contract 22-
HQJP-018. A First Amendment was approved September 19, 2025 to extend the
Project Completion and Maintenance Period Completion Dates.

Hormel Foods Corporation and Progressive Processing, LLC have requested an
additional extension of the Project Completion Date, and the IEDA board has approved
the request. The attached Second Amendment amends the Project Completion and
Maintenance Period Completion Dates.
The Iowa Economic Development Authority requested City approval of the Second
Amendment to Economic Development Assistance Contract 22-HQJP-018 on June 30,
2026 for the extension of the Project Completion Date. The Mayor has signed the Second
Amendment and seeks ratification of the Second Amendment by the City Council.

EXHIBIT D — JOB OBLIGATIONS
Amended 6/19/2026
Recipient: Hormel Foods Corporation and Progressive Processing, LLC
Community: City of Dubuque
Contract Number: 22-HQJP-018
This Project has been awarded Project Completion Assistance and Tax Incentives from the High Quality Jobs Program (HQJP) — Tax
Credit Component. The chart below outline the contractual job obligations related to this Project.
Data in the "Employment Base" column has been verified by IEDA and reflects the employment characteristics of the facility
receiving funding before this award was made. Jobs to be retained as a part of this Project must be included in these calculations.
Data in the "Jobs To Be Created" column outlines the new full-time jobs (including their wage characteristics) that must be added to
the employment base and, if applicable, statewide employment base as a result of this award.
At the Project Completion Date and through the Maintenance Period Completion Date, the Recipient must achieve, at a minimum, the
numbers found in the "Total Job Obligations" column.

Notes re: Job Obligations
1. When determining the number of jobs at or above the qualifying wage, wages will include only the regular hourly rate
that serves as the base level of compensation. The wage will not include nonregular forms of compensation such as
bonuses, unusual overtime pay, commissions, stock options, pension, retirement or death benefits, unemployment benefits
or other insurance, or other fringe benefits.
2. Employment Base includes 0 "Retained Jobs".
If the Recipient uses or proposes to use a non-standard work week (8 hours a day, 5 days a week, 52 weeks a year including
holidays, vacation and other paid leave), check the box below and describe that alternative schedule. The alternative
schedule must meet the requirements of 261 IAC 173.2. If the box is not checked or if no alternative schedule is
provided, IEDA will consider "Full-time Equivalent (FTE) Job" to mean the employment of one person for 8 hours per
day for a 5-day, 40-hour workweek for 52 weeks per year, including paid holidays, vacations and other paid leave.
❑ The Recipient shall use an alternative work week for purposes of its employees described in the Contract. The alternative
work week is as follows: [description].
Sufficient Benefits Deductible Requirements
Recipient shall provide Sufficient Benefits with a maximum deductible of $1,700 for single coverage or $3,750 for
family coverage.
